CVE-2025-23115

Remediation/Mitigation Strategy: CVE-2025-23115 - UniFi Protect Camera Use-After-Free RCE

This document outlines a remediation and mitigation strategy for CVE-2025-23115, a Use-After-Free vulnerability affecting UniFi Protect Cameras.

1. Vulnerability Description:

  • CVE ID: CVE-2025-23115
  • Vulnerability Type: Use-After-Free (UAF)
  • Affected Product: UniFi Protect Cameras
  • Description: A Use-After-Free vulnerability exists in the UniFi Protect Camera software. This vulnerability allows a remote attacker with access to the UniFi Protect Cameras management network to potentially execute arbitrary code on the affected device. A Use-After-Free condition occurs when memory is freed, but a pointer to that memory is still held and subsequently used. This can lead to crashes, unexpected behavior, or, in this case, arbitrary code execution.

2. Severity Assessment:

  • CVSS Score: 9.0 (Critical)

  • CVSS Vector: AV:A/AC:L/PR:N/UI:N/S:C/C:H/I:H/A:H (Approximate based on provided CVSS scores - requires network access and high impact on Confidentiality, Integrity, and Availability)

    • AV:A (Attack Vector: Adjacent Network): An attacker must be on the same physical or logical network segment as the vulnerable system.
    • AC:L (Attack Complexity: Low): Specialized access conditions or extenuating circumstances do not exist.
    • PR:N (Privileges Required: None): The attacker does not need any privileges to exploit the vulnerability.
    • UI:N (User Interaction: None): No user interaction is required to exploit the vulnerability.
    • S:C (Scope: Changed): An exploited vulnerability can affect resources beyond the security scope managed by the security authority of the vulnerable component.
    • C:H (Confidentiality: High): There is total information disclosure, resulting in all resources within the compromised system being divulged to the attacker.
    • I:H (Integrity: High): There is a total compromise of system integrity. There is a complete loss of system protection, resulting in the entire system being vulnerable.
    • A:H (Availability: High): There is a total loss of availability or integrity to system resources.
  • Impact: Successful exploitation of this vulnerability could allow a remote attacker to:

    • Gain complete control of the UniFi Protect Camera.
    • Access and potentially exfiltrate video and audio feeds.
    • Use the compromised camera as a pivot point to attack other devices on the network.
    • Cause denial of service (DoS) conditions by crashing the camera.

3. Known Exploits:

  • While the provided information doesn’t detail specific exploit code, the fact that the vulnerability exists and has a high CVSS score indicates that exploit development is likely. Expect publicly available exploits to emerge if they haven’t already. Act quickly.

4. Remediation/Mitigation Strategy:

The primary goal is to eliminate the Use-After-Free vulnerability and prevent its exploitation.

  • Immediate Action (Within 24-48 hours):

    • Identify Affected Devices: Inventory all UniFi Protect Cameras within the network and determine their firmware versions. This will enable targeted patching.
    • Network Segmentation: If feasible, isolate the UniFi Protect Camera network segment from the rest of the network. This will limit the potential blast radius of a successful exploit. Consider using a VLAN with restricted routing.
    • Access Control Lists (ACLs): Implement strict ACLs on the UniFi Protect Camera network segment to only allow necessary traffic (e.g., from the UniFi Protect Controller, authorized viewing stations). Block all unnecessary inbound and outbound traffic.
    • Monitor Network Traffic: Implement network monitoring and intrusion detection systems (IDS) to detect suspicious activity originating from or targeting UniFi Protect Cameras. Look for unusual network patterns or attempts to exploit known vulnerabilities.
  • Short-Term (Within 1 week):

    • Apply Firmware Updates: The most critical step is to immediately apply the latest firmware updates provided by Ubiquiti (UniFi). These updates are likely to address the CVE-2025-23115 vulnerability. Check the Ubiquiti website or UniFi Protect Controller for available updates.
    • Verify Update Success: After applying the firmware updates, verify that the cameras have successfully updated to the latest version.
    • UniFi Protect Controller Security: Ensure the UniFi Protect Controller itself is secured with strong passwords, multi-factor authentication (MFA), and is running the latest version of its software. Compromise of the Controller could amplify the impact of the camera vulnerability.
  • Long-Term (Within 1 month):

    • Regular Security Audits: Conduct regular security audits and penetration testing of the UniFi Protect Camera network segment.
    • Vulnerability Management Program: Implement a formal vulnerability management program to identify and address security vulnerabilities in a timely manner.
    • Password Management: Enforce strong password policies for all UniFi Protect Camera accounts.
    • Least Privilege Access: Ensure that users only have the minimum level of access required to perform their job functions.
    • Enable Automatic Updates (if available and thoroughly tested): If UniFi provides an option for automatic firmware updates, consider enabling it after carefully testing the updates in a controlled environment. This will help to ensure that security patches are applied promptly.
    • Consider Alternatives: Evaluate alternative security camera systems with a strong security track record. If the current system proves to be consistently vulnerable, switching to a more secure alternative may be necessary.

5. Communication Plan:

  • Internal Communication: Communicate the vulnerability and remediation plan to all relevant stakeholders, including IT staff, security personnel, and management.
  • External Communication: Follow Ubiquiti’s recommended communication channels for security vulnerabilities. Provide updates to users regarding the status of the remediation efforts.

6. Monitoring and Reporting:

  • Continuous Monitoring: Continuously monitor the UniFi Protect Camera network segment for any signs of suspicious activity.
  • Incident Response Plan: Ensure that an incident response plan is in place to handle any security incidents related to the UniFi Protect Cameras.
  • Reporting: Regularly report on the status of the remediation efforts and any security incidents.

Important Considerations:

  • Official Ubiquiti Guidance: Always refer to the official Ubiquiti documentation and security advisories for the most up-to-date information on this vulnerability and recommended remediation steps.
  • Testing: Thoroughly test all updates and configuration changes in a non-production environment before deploying them to the production network.
  • Vendor Support: Maintain contact with Ubiquiti support for assistance with any issues encountered during the remediation process.

By implementing this remediation and mitigation strategy, you can significantly reduce the risk of CVE-2025-23115 being exploited and protect your UniFi Protect Cameras and network. Remember to prioritize applying the firmware updates and isolating the camera network segment.

Assigner

Date

  • Published Date: 2025-03-01 01:52:36
  • Updated Date: 2025-03-01 03:15:23

More Details

CVE-2025-23115